Hounslow

A Hounslow serviced office positions your business within a highly productive area, which generates £14.9 billion annually, a figure comparable to many UK cities. This borough is strategically located on the Great West Corridor, an established hub for international headquarters, including Sky, Paramount, and National Geographic. This significant concentration of corporate activity consistently attracts further investment, cementing Hounslow's enduring commercial importance.

Hounslow also offers businesses practical advantages, boosting efficiency. The strong transport links are a key benefit, ensuring easy access for the client workforce. Furthermore, the continuous regeneration has resulted in modernised commercial property. The local authority's focus on enterprise is a crucial factor, as it expands the availability of affordable workspace and provides targeted, sector-specific assistance. This strategic advantage enables firms to secure cost-effective premises in Hounslow for growth, effectively bypassing the high prices of central London.
